One of those players is superstar San Francisco 49ers receiver Deebo Samuel. As one of the best 49ers’ best players and, well, a professional athlete, Samuel is kind of obligated to show up in fine football-playing shape. That apparently didn’t stop the wideout from diligently sharing his progress with head coach Kyle Shahanan.
When Shanahan spoke during the 49ers’ introductory training camp press conference, he complimented Samuel’s fitness. At the same time, he also roasted him for texting him so many pictures with his shirt off.
#49ers Kyle Shanahan on WR Deebo Samuel hardcore preparation for the 2023 season:
"Never had a grown man send me so many pictures of himself with his shirt off, but he looked good." pic.twitter.com/yQpYRohv7V
